2013-02-26 2 views
0

Я хочу создать клиент telnet, который можно использовать с помощью специального устройства контроля температуры в моей сети, которое представляет собой меню для настройки на основе telnet.Как создать представление для клиента telnet iOS?

Я создал несколько простых приложений для iOS раньше, но никогда не создавал пользовательские представления. То, что я хочу создать, является терминальным окном, которое может печатать (и обертывать) текст, прокручивать и, конечно, обрабатывать ввод пользователя, который должен быть введен в текущей позиции.

Какой подход вы предложили бы создать такой интерфейс? Я слышал о «Core Text», возможно, это вариант? Должен ли я лучше использовать OpenGL для этого? Можно ли включить «копировать и вставлять» текст, который отображается с использованием этих методов без повторного включения в колесо?

Заранее благодарен!

ответ

2

Самый простой способ, вероятно, использовать UITextView. Кажется, он делает все, что вам нужно, и разрешает стилизованный текст под iOS 6.

Выполнять свои собственные было бы трудно, но да, я бы использовал Core Text. Вам придется изобретать колесо, чтобы получить копию и вставку, но вы могли бы использовать некоторые из элементов UIResponder, UIMenuItem и других текстовых систем.

+0

отличный, спасибо! – muffel

Смежные вопросы